Showing ordinances that apply to Lake Harbor, FL
Lake Harbor is an unincorporated community (population 49) in Palm Beach County, Florida. Because Lake Harbor is not an incorporated city, it does not have its own municipal code. Instead, Palm Beach County ordinances apply directly to properties here. The snow & sidewalk clearing rules below are the ones that govern your area.
Not applicable. Palm Beach County is in subtropical South Florida and does not receive snowfall. No snow removal ordinances exist.
Palm Beach County has a tropical/subtropical climate with no recorded measurable snowfall in modern history. No municipal or county snow-clearing ordinances exist. Property owners are responsible for keeping sidewalks free of vegetation, debris, and obstructions under PBC Code Chapter 14, but snow is not a regulated condition.
